If you’ve ever loaned your car to a friend or borrowed someone else’s vehicle, you may have wondered what happens if an accident occurs. Would the vehicle owner’s insurance apply — or would the driver’s policy take over?

In most situations, auto insurance follows the vehicle first, not the driver. That means the car's policy is usually the primary source of coverage in the event of an accident. However, that’s not always the case. Swipe for some key details about when the vehicle owner’s policy kicks in and when the driver’s policy is used.

With summer travel picking up, our team wanted to share a few helpful reminders about how Medicare works when you’re away from home.

Many people assume their coverage will follow them no matter where they go, but that’s not always the case. Depending on your plan, factors such as provider access, network rules, and even geography can affect what’s covered and how much you may pay out of pocket if you need care while you’re away from home.

The good news is that a little planning ahead of your trip can help you avoid surprises and feel more confident if something unexpected comes up while you’re traveling. Swipe for a few things to keep in mind as you prepare for any summer travel.
